Insulate your home
Double-glazed windows are a great way to insulate your house. They are designed to cut down on noise and also provide insulation. Double glazing is not the only choice. In fact, there are numerous ways to improve the efficiency of your windows.
A single-paned glass window could be able to lose 10 times the heat of an insulated wall, according to estimates. This is particularly evident during the winter seasons when homes are chilly. Insulation can be added to make windows more efficient.
It can be easily added to existing windows. Window film is a cost-effective and easy way to add this feature to your windows. Window film is a thin, transparent membrane made of plastic that is placed inside the window frame. The film traps air between the glass and the film.
You can also seal the gap between the wall and your window frame using caulk. This is a simple and inexpensive way to insulate your windows. Water-based caulk is easy to apply. If your windows have gaps smaller than a quarter inch, you can use a caulking gun to apply the caulk.
Another method is to add an gas layer to act as an insulator. Depending on your requirements, you can use argon or krypton, or Xenon. These gases help to disperse heat and reduce the energy transfer.
Another option to insulate your home is to construct thermal curtains. Three layers of material comprise the thermal curtains. They are a great way to keep your house cool in the summer and warm in the winter.
It is also possible to increase the efficiency of your double glazed windows by installing an insulation glass unit. Insulated glass units are usually composed of two sheets of glass that have been separated by an inert gas. This option is available from many of the most reputable window manufacturers.
Double-glazed windows can help make your home warmer during winter, and cooler during summer. They also help reduce condensation. Condensation could cause mildew, mould, or rot in wooden frames.

Prevent condensation
Condensation is the process of forming of droplets of water on the surface. It happens when the surface's temperature is lower than the temperature of the air. Condensation forms when warm, humid air meets cool glass.
The humidity inside your home is typically the cause of condensation on double-glazed windows. This could be due to various reasons, including the inability to circulate air. A dehumidifier can help to lower the moisture levels in the home. However, it will not stop the formation of condensation.
